As we enter a new year, many of us are looking ahead and thinking about how we can improve ourselves and our lives. For those struggling with mental health issues, it's especially important to focus on ways to promote better mental well-being. Here are ten tips that can help you take care of your mental health in 2025

1. Prioritize self-care Taking time for activities that bring joy and relaxation is crucial for maintaining good mental health.

2. Practice mindfulness Cultivating mindful awareness through techniques like meditation or deep breathing can reduce stress levels and improve focus and clarity.

3. Connect with others Building relationships, whether it be family, friends or colleagues, provides social support networks which help buffer against depression and anxiety disorders.

4. Get moving Engaging in physical activity has been linked to improvements in mood and overall mental health; aim for at least 30 minutes most days of the week.

5. Seek professional help when needed - Talking with a qualified therapist can be invaluable for those dealing with more severe mental health challenges such as depression or PTSD.
